运用 CSS 的 absolute 与 relative 制作的提示

2008-02-23 08:46:18来源:互联网 阅读 ()

新老客户大回馈,云服务器低至5折

实现 ToolTips 的方法有很多,大多数用 JS,下面是用纯 CSS 制作的,定位上运用了 absolute 与 relative。

详细代码:

<p>Text</p>
<p><a class="tooltips" href="#" >Link<span>ToolTips</span></a></p>
<p>Text</p>

<style type="text/css">
.tooltips{
position:relative;
z-index:1;
text-decoration:none;
}
.tooltips:hover{
z-index:2;
background:none; /* 没有这个在 IE 中不可用 */
}
.tooltips span{
display:none; /* span 不可见 */
}
.tooltips:hover span{ /* span 标签仅在 :hover 状态时显示 */
display:block;
position:absolute;
top:20px;
left:20px;
width:100px; /* ToolTips 的宽度 */
/* 以下是样式 */
border:1px solid #D5C88B;
background:#FEFEE6;
padding:4px;
color:#A1870D;
}
body{
font-family:verdana;
font-size:12px;
}
</style>

标签:

版权申明:本站文章部分自网络,如有侵权,请联系:west999com@outlook.com
特别注意:本站所有转载文章言论不代表本站观点,本站所提供的摄影照片,插画,设计作品,如需使用,请与原作者联系,版权归原作者所有

上一篇:标准与习惯:在解决ul居中问题时想到的

下一篇:无内容div占据空间的触发条件和解决方法